AND THE WORD WAS GOD John 1:1-14
I. THE SCRIPTURE'S EXPLANATION
A. The origin of Christ v. la; In the beginning was the Word,
Psalms 90:2 Before the mountains were brought forth, or ever thou
hadst formed
the earth and the world, even from everlasting to everlasting,
thou art God.
B. The position of Christ, v. 1b, and the Word was with God
Hebrews 10:12But this man, after he had offered one sacrifice
for sins for ever,
sat down on the right hand of God;
C. The description of Christ, v. 1c, and the Word was God.
John 10:30I and my Father are one.
D. The creation by Christ, v. 3;All things were made by him; and
without him was
not any thing made that was made.
II. THE SERVANT'S PROCLAMATION
A. Notice his ordination,v. 6a; There was a man sent from God
B. Notice his identification, v. 6b;whose name was John.
C. Notice his occupation, v. 7a; The same came for a witness,
to bear witness of
the Light
D. Notice his intention, v. 7bthat all men through him might believe.,
John 1:8He was not that Light, but was sent to bear witness of
that Light.
III. THE SAVIOUR'S REVELATION
A. By his incarnation, v. 14;And the Word was made flesh, and
dwelt among us,
(and we beheld his glory, the glory as of the only begotten of
the Father,) full
of grace and truth.
Romans 8:3For what the law could not do, in that it was weak through
the flesh,
God sending his own Son in the likeness of sinful flesh, and for
sin, condemned
sin in the flesh
B. By his habitation, v. 10a; He was in the world, and the world
was made by him
Matthew 1:23Behold, a virgin shall be with child, and shall bring
forth a son,
and they shall call his name Emmanuel, which being interpreted
is, God with us.
C. By his illumination, v. 9;Thatwas the true Light, which lighteth
every man
that cometh into the world.
John 3:19 And this is the condemnation, that light is come into
the world, and
men loved darkness rather than light, because their deeds were
evil.
IV. THE SINNER'S SITUATION
A. No comprehension, v. 5;And the light shineth in darkness; and
the darkness
comprehended it not.
B. No conviction, v. 10b; and the world knew him not.
Romans 3:18 There is no fear of God before their eyes.
C. No conversion, v. 11;He came unto his own, and his own received
him not.
John 5:40And ye will not come to me, that ye might have life.
V. THE SAINT'S RECEPTION
A. The election, v. 13; Which were born, not of blood, nor of
the will of the
flesh, nor of the will of man, but of God.
B. The salvation, v. 12; But as many as received him, to them
gave he power
to become the sons of God, even to them that believe on his name:
Rom. 10: 13For whosoever shall call upon the name of the Lord
shall be saved.
C. The transformation, v. 12; But as many as received him, to
them gave he
power to become the sons of God, even to them that believe on
his name:
Romans 8:16-17 The Spirit itself beareth witness with our spirit,
that we are
the children of God: And if children, then heirs; heirs of God,
and joint-heirs
with Christ; if so be that we suffer with him, that we may be
also glorified
together.
